What Are Virtual CFO Services?

Virtual CFO Services are professional financial consulting solutions delivered remotely. These services act as a part-time or outsourced CFO for your business, offering high-level financial direction and support tailored to your goals.

Key Offerings Include:
  • Strategic financial planning and analysis

     

  • Budgeting and forecasting

     

  • Cash flow management

     

  • Compliance support

     

  • Financial reporting

     

  • Coordination of bookkeeping and accounting services

     

  • Guidance on auditing and assurance services

Unlike full-time CFOs, virtual CFOs work on a flexible model—perfect for startups, growing businesses, or organizations seeking expert guidance without long-term commitment

How Virtual CFO Services Help Reduce Business Costs

One of the biggest advantages of Virtual CFO Services is cost reduction. Let’s break down how businesses save money:

1. Eliminates Full-Time CFO Salary & Overhead

Hiring an in-house CFO means paying six-figure salaries, benefits, bonuses, and infrastructure costs. A virtual CFO provides the same level of expertise at a fraction of the cost.

2. Prevents Costly Financial Mistakes

Mismanaged finances or non-compliance can result in heavy penalties. Virtual CFOs ensure accurate financial reporting, budgeting, and decision-making, reducing the risk of expensive errors.

3. Improves Cash Flow Management

With a vCFO, your business can maintain healthy cash flow through strategic planning and monitoring. They ensure capital is allocated efficiently and warn you of potential liquidity challenges in advance.

4. Leverages Technology for Efficiency

Virtual CFOs utilize cloud-based accounting tools, automation software, and data analytics platforms to streamline operations, reduce manual effort, and cut down operational expenses.

5. Avoids Fines & Penalties via Timely Compliance

Whether it’s tax deadlines or regulatory filings, vCFOs keep your business compliant—protecting you from unnecessary fines, delays, and legal hassles.

Strategic Decision-Making with a Virtual CFO

Beyond saving money, vCFOs play a pivotal role in improving your business decisions. Here’s how:

1. Better Financial Forecasting & Budgeting

Virtual CFOs use historical data, market trends, and forecasting models to create realistic budgets and projections that guide smarter business planning.

2. Data-Driven Insights for Smarter Planning

By analyzing financial performance indicators and trends, vCFOs provide clear, actionable insights—enabling you to make confident, informed decisions.

3. Support for Investment & Growth Decisions

From evaluating new opportunities to risk management, vCFOs help businesses understand the financial implications of every major move.

4. Regular Financial Reporting & KPIs Tracking

They prepare detailed monthly or quarterly reports that track profitability, cash flow, expenses, and performance against KPIs—ensuring transparency and accountability.

5. Advisory Support for C-level Executives

A vCFO often works directly with founders or CEOs, offering high-level strategic advice for growth, financing, mergers, or exits.

Q 1. What’s the difference between a Virtual CFO and an Accountant?
Ans: An accountant focuses on transactional tasks like bookkeeping and tax filing, whereas a virtual CFO offers strategic financial leadership, forecasting, and business planning.

Q 2. How much do Virtual CFO Services typically cost?
Ans: Costs vary depending on the scope and provider but are generally far lower than hiring a full-time CFO. Monthly packages often range from $1,000 to $5,000.

Q 3. Can Virtual CFOs work with existing accounting software?
Ans: Most vCFOs are proficient with tools like QuickBooks, Xero, NetSuite, and other ERP platforms, ensuring seamless integration with your current systems.
